3Chlorohexane
3-Chlorohexane is an organochlorine compound with the chemical formula C6H13Cl. It is a colorless liquid at room temperature. As a haloalkane, it features a chlorine atom bonded to a hexane chain. The chlorine atom is attached to the third carbon atom of the hexane structure, hence the prefix "3-chloro".
